gpt4 book ai didi

wordpress - 我的标题 WordPress 之前有奇怪的文字

转载 作者:行者123 更新时间:2023-12-03 06:58:33 26 4
gpt4 key购买 nike

我昨天更新了新的 WordPress 版本,从那时起,我的网站顶部出现了这个奇怪的文本,就在标题上方,工具栏应该在的地方。

window._wpemojiSettings = {
"baseUrl": "http:\/\/s.w.org\/images\/core\/emoji\/72x72\/",
"ext": ".png",
"source": {
"concatemoji": "http:\/\/localhost\/wordpress\/wp-includes\/js\/wp-emoji-release.min.js?ver=4.2.1"
}
};
! function(a, b, c) {
function d(a) {
var c = b.createElement("canvas"),
d = c.getContext && c.getContext("2d");
return d && d.fillText ? (d.textBaseline = "top", d.font = "600 32px Arial", "flag" === a ? (d.fillText(String.fromCharCode(55356, 56812, 55356, 56807), 0, 0), c.toDataURL().length > 3e3) : (d.fillText(String.fromCharCode(55357, 56835), 0, 0), 0 !== d.getImageData(16, 16, 1, 1).data[0])) : !1
}

function e(a) {
var c = b.createElement("script");
c.src = a, c.type = "text/javascript", b.getElementsByTagName("head")[0].appendChild(c)
}
var f;
c.supports = {
simple: d("simple"),
flag: d("flag")
}, c.supports.simple && c.supports.flag || (f = c.source || {}, f.concatemoji ? e(f.concatemoji) : f.wpemoji && f.twemoji && (e(f.twemoji), e(f.wpemoji)))
}(window, document, window._wpemojiSettings);

有人知道吗?

最佳答案

我们将挂接到 init 并删除操作,如下所示:

function disable_wp_emojicons() {

// all actions related to emojis
remove_action( 'admin_print_styles', 'print_emoji_styles' );
remove_action( 'wp_head', 'print_emoji_detection_script', 7 );
remove_action( 'admin_print_scripts', 'print_emoji_detection_script' );
remove_action( 'wp_print_styles', 'print_emoji_styles' );
remove_filter( 'wp_mail', 'wp_staticize_emoji_for_email' );
remove_filter( 'the_content_feed', 'wp_staticize_emoji' );
remove_filter( 'comment_text_rss', 'wp_staticize_emoji' );

// filter to remove TinyMCE emojis
add_filter( 'tiny_mce_plugins', 'disable_emojicons_tinymce' );
}
add_action( 'init', 'disable_wp_emojicons' );

我们需要以下过滤函数来禁用 TinyMCE 表情符号:

function disable_emojicons_tinymce( $plugins ) {
if ( is_array( $plugins ) ) {
return array_diff( $plugins, array( 'wpemoji' ) );
} else {
return array();
}
}

现在我们呼吸并假装这个功能从未添加到核心中...特别是当大量已解决错误 yet待实现。

这可以作为插件使用,Disable Emojis

或者,您可以使用 Classic Smilies 将表情符号替换为 WordPress 早期版本的原始版本。 .

PS:我试图将此问题标记为 185577 的重复问题

关于wordpress - 我的标题 WordPress 之前有奇怪的文字,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29960915/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com